Codependency often involves putting others’ needs ahead of your own, struggling with boundaries, and seeking self-worth through approval or caretaking. In therapy, we’ll work together to explore these patterns, build healthier relationships, and reconnect with your own needs, values, and identity. Through a compassionate, supportive process, you can learn to set boundaries, improve self-esteem, and create more balanced, fulfilling connections.
